**What your role will be**
Reporting to the Regional Manager, you will be responsible for the installation, commissioning,
servicing and maintenance of commercial and residential security systems, this includes;
Alarm Systems, CCTV Systems, ACS (Access Control Systems), Access Gates, Intercoms
and IP Networks.

**What you need to bring**
To be successful in the role you’ll need:
5+ years experience in the electronic security industry.
Experienced in NZ Witness, Vivotech and Axis CCTV systems
Experienced in gate automation
Strong communication and customer service skills, as you will be customer facing.
Strong problem solving abilities, along with resilience to cope under pressure.
You must have a current Drivers License and a current Security License (COA) or be able
to obtain one.
An Electrical License with the EWRB is advantageous, but also not a pre-requisite.
